About This Item
Hardcover. Good. New York: Charles Scribner's Sons. 1880, first edition, first printing. Hard Cover. Good. 435 pages plus advertisements. Almost Very good decor. stamped green cloth hardcover in no Djacket as issued, Brief ext. scuffing at edges, black floral decor front cover and spine, bright gilt lettering on spine. Handsome bookplate on floral front endpaperr. Binding VG. Contemporary (19th C.) pencilled note in back. A few pps. turned down.
